Marketing Specialist eMail & Push Notification (f/m/d)

- fixed term contract for 2 years -

Our ambition as eBay is to build the world’s best marketing platform to drive relevant buyer engagement at scale. As marketing specialist, you will be responsible for our push channels (email, notifications) and have direct impact on growing and retaining our customer base via push notifications and emails.

Your job is to plan, execute and improve our local marketing campaigns for our push channels email and mobile notifications. You have the unique opportunity to grow both channels and improve the buyer funnel by delivering strong and relevant messages to our customers.

Within your role you work with multiple teams including local campaign managers, global product owners and external marketing agencies. You are a good communicator, creative thinker and hands-on executer.

We are looking for motivated colleague, who is eager to learn and have some fun along the way, in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.

You will:

  • Work closely with the Business Units and Campaign Managers to deliver a strong communication plan for both channels to increase customer engagement
  • Brief agencies and ensure high customer relevance and creative quality
  • Optimize relevancy for our customers by applying various targeting segments using all technical capabilities
  • Execute and schedule campaigns in high quality including testing and monitoring
  • Reporting and testing in order to ultimately optimize campaign and channel performance

You are:

  • Organized and able to work quickly, yet with an eye for details – even under time pressure
  • Independent and creative problem solver, who is passionate about enhancing the user experience
  • Strong in collaboration and coordinating multiple teams within a broad set of different projects
  • Able to work both independently and in a team, collaborative environment is essential
  • A Self-starter with plenty of initiative and drive

You Have:

  • Graduate degree (Bachelor or Master)
  • first experience in online marketing (1-2 years)
  • Skills in the use of Excel, Powerpoint and Word
  • Fluency in written and spoken English and German
